(Booth 9519) Sapheneia of Jackson, MS, will demonstrate new developments in its Clarity line of software, which is designed to optimize medical images to enable studies to be acquired with less radiation dose.

Clarity CT reduces radiation dose by 20% to 80% depending on anatomy and improves the visualization of images obtained at very low radiation doses. The application is particularly well-suited for pediatric and obese patients, the company said. The software can be integrated into a facility's existing workflow, and it is scalable from an entry-level application to an enterprise-level installation.

In addition to selling to end users, Sapheneia is offering the software to OEMs and has a version of the software available as a software development kit (SDK). Clarity has been approved by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ration.
